A few don't appear to be going to US with main squad....

Care of mcfcreport.com


Breaking: Phil Foden, Ilkay Gündogan, and John Stones will not be travelling with Manchester City for the American leg of their pre-season preparations. There is no confirmation over the reasons why the three players are not travelling. They will fly to another destination in Europe with #ManCity's U-23s to continue their pre season programme.

[via Sami Mokbel - Daily Mail]

Possibly covid related?
